我想在应用程序中使用angular,但默认情况下不会在应用程序中加载角度.单击某个特定按钮时,会创建一个新div,我想在该div上使用angular. 我正在使用yepnode加载角度,如下面的代码所示:yepnope({test:window.angular,nope: ['/filesystem/content/js/angular.js'],complete: function(){ console.log('complete');} });鉴于我已加载角度,我可以访问div为$div,我的下一个操作将是1. Create some html and use it as the innerHTML of ...
我正在使用一个相当简单的系统来动态加载javascript:include = function (url) {var e = document.createElement("script");e.src = url;e.type="text/javascript";document.getElementsByTagName("head")[0].appendChild(e); };假设我有一个test.js文件,其中包含以下内容:var foo = 4;现在,在我原来的脚本中,我想使用include(test.js); console.log(foo);但是,我得到了一个’foo尚未定义’的错误.我猜它与包含在< head>的最后一...
我使用jquery.load函数动态加载页面,但加载的页面没有绑定到viewModel? app.jsfunction viewModel(){var self = this;self.users = ko.observable();Sammy(function() {this.get("#/users",function() {$.get("/api/users",function(data){self.users(data);});$("#content").load("pages/users.html");});}).run("#/"); }ko.applyBindings(new viewModel());index.html的:<html><body><div id="content"></div><script src="sta...
我正在使用JQuery在网页的正文选项卡中动态注入脚本标记.我有类似的东西:function addJS(url) {$("body").append('<script type="text/javascript" src='+url+'></script>'); }我以这种方式添加了几个脚本,并尝试使用它们. E.G: lib.jsfunction core() {...} alert("I'am here !");init.jsaddJS("lib.js"); c = new core();的test.html<html><head><title>test</title> <script type="text/javascript" src="init.js"></...
Apple.com始终首先显示标准图像,然后使用javascript加载视网膜图像(如果设备支持视网膜). 我想知道苹果为什么不直接使用CSS媒体查询来减少HTTP请求?解决方法:简答 – 浏览器预取. 除了使用JS之外,他们无能为力: >进行媒体查询测试,使用JS,并在有支持的情况下填写HQ图像>进行媒体查询测试,使用JS并填写CSS样式表(其中包含url声明),如果有支持的话. 这里的目标不是减少HTTP请求.目标是减少并发HTTP请求,对于大部分冗余的数据 – 甚...
我正在使用PapaParse从文件输入加载csv文件. 目前,我有一个工作版本,我使用脚本标记加载PapaParse:<script type="text/javascript" src="papaparse.js" ></script>并处理更改事件:Papa.parse(event.target.files[0], {complete: function(results) {...} }我现在想使用webpack捆绑我的js,我想在我需要时动态加载PapaParse,而不是每次都进入全局命名空间.像这样的东西:require("./papaparse.js").Papa.parse(event.target.files[...
我正在动态加载和运行存储在YAML文件中的磁盘上的JavaScript代码.我想知道是否有可能(使用intelliJ)调试JS代码,即使我没有从独立的JS文件加载它.要简化问题描述,请考虑以下Java代码:NashornScriptEngineFactory nashornFactory = new NashornScriptEngineFactory(); ScriptEngine engine = nashornFactory.getScriptEngine(); engine.eval("var a = 1 + 1;\nprint(a);");如何在第二行设置断点(“打印”函数调用),如何检查变量“a”...
今天我一直在加载动态JavaScript代码(文件).我使用的解决方案是:function loadScript(scriptUrl) {var head = document.getElementsByTagName("head")[0];var script = document.createElement('script');script.id = 'uploadScript';script.type = 'text/javascript';script.src = scriptUrl;head.appendChild(script);}这个问题是我不知道如何确保脚本内容何时执行.由于脚本包含类(很好的JS类),我写下了一个通过setTimeout调用的...
我在这里有我的代码,它在正文的末尾插入一个预定义的模态标记:var languageModal = '<div id="lngModal" class="modal hide fade" tabindex="-1" role="dialog" aria-labelledby="lngModalLabel" aria-hidden="true">'+ ' <div class="modal-body"></div>'+ ' <div class="modal-footer">'+ ' <form class="inline" id="lngModalForm">'+ ' <button class="btn btn-primary" data-dismiss="modal" aria-hidd...
我正在尝试为单选按钮创建一个通用输入字段,我将在我的项目中使用每当我需要在reactjs中的单选按钮,所以我想知道如何动态传递单选按钮,以便默认情况下检查第一个元素以及如何在map函数中使用checked属性render() {var self = this;return(<div>{self.props.options.map(function(option){return <label key={option[self.props.id]}><input type="radio" className={self.props.className}checked={?????} key={option[self.props....
有一个page1.html(我在浏览器中打开它):<div id="content"> </div> <script type="text/JavaScript">jQuery.ajax({type : "GET",url : 'page2.html',dataType : "html",success : function(response) { jQuery('#content').append(response);}}); </script>page2.html的代码:<script type="text/JavaScript" src="js/page2.js"></script><script type="text/JavaScript"> test(); </script>页面代码js / page2.js:func...
经过一个多小时试图让它工作,我认为这是因为跨域政策,但我真的认为这会奏效.我也找不到很多关于它的信息.但是,这是我的问题.我有一个名为http://mysite.com的网站,然后我包含了第三方脚本(我正在写什么)及其在http://supercoolsite.com/api/script.js,这个脚本需要在运行之前动态加载google maps api:http://maps.google.com/maps/api/js?sensor=false.好吧,我认为这段代码可行:function loadScript(filename,callback){var file...
用更少的话来说: 我有多个JavaScript部分位于文档的不同位置.其中一些是使用AJAX加载和评估的:<script id="js5533" type="text/javascript">javascript and jquery stuff (lots) </script> <script id="js7711" type="text/javascript">javascript and jquery stuff (lots) </script>正如你所看到的,每个部分我都是ID. 我的目标是通过单击按钮摆脱特定部分.$('.somebutton').click(function() {$('#js7711').remove(); });当然,此...
我的项目需要大约150种字体.最初加载所有字体会增加页面加载时间. 我试过谷歌搜索但找不到答案. 场景: 用户将从< select>中选择字体选项.标签.点击后,我必须动态检索字体并确保浏览器呈现字体,然后使用字体来避免无格式文本Flash(FOUT) 目前我正在使用AJAX来请求该字体文件$.ajax({type: 'GET',url: "font-file-url",async:false,success: function(data) {$("style").prepend("@font-face {\n" +"\tfont-family: \""+fontValue+"...
我正在尝试根据参数将模板加载到Angular应用程序中.这将是一个ng-foreach:<body ng-app="MyApp" ng-controller="ExampleController as example"><div ng-repeat="item in example.items" class="someClass" ng-switch="item.type"><!-- load a different template (partial) depending on the value of item.type --></div> </body>小提琴:https://jsfiddle.net/rsvmar2n/1/ 我可以以某种方式这样做吗?我在考虑使用ng-switch:...